Emergency Response and Coordination Protocols

After a New York bridge accident, first responders follow strict coordination protocols to clear lanes, treat injuries, and preserve evidence. Fire, police, and emergency medical services communicate through unified command centers to minimize downtime and public risk. These procedures are regularly tested through joint drills involving state and city entities.

Infrastructure Inspections and Preventive Measures

Routine infrastructure inspections aim to identify structural weaknesses before they lead to a New York bridge accident. Sensors, drone surveys, and manual inspections feed data into risk models that prioritize repairs and maintenance. Public agencies face pressure to allocate funding swiftly while balancing long term projects across the region.

Traffic Impact and Commuter Guidance

A New York bridge accident typically triggers lane closures, detours, and significant delays for cars, buses, and trucks. Real time alerts are published through navigation apps, highway message boards, and official social media channels. Travelers are advised to check alternate routes, consider public transit, and allow extra time during peak periods.

What should I do immediately if I am involved in a New York bridge accident?

Move to a safe location if possible, check for injuries, contact 911, and exchange information with other drivers. Document the scene with photos and notes, then report the incident to the relevant bridge authority and your insurance provider promptly.

How are responsibility and liability determined after a New York bridge accident?

Liability is established through police reports, witness statements, traffic camera footage, and forensic analysis of vehicle damage. If structural failure or maintenance negligence contributed, government agencies or contractors may share responsibility alongside individual drivers.

Can weather conditions be cited as a cause in a New York bridge accident claim?

Weather may be factored into investigations, but it does not automatically absolve liability. Courts examine whether parties took reasonable precautions given conditions such as ice, fog, or high winds, and whether speed or following distance were appropriate.

How do New York bridge accident statistics influence future infrastructure investments?

Aggregated accident data highlights recurring hotspots, design flaws, or operational issues, prompting targeted upgrades. Planners use these insights to justify budget requests for repairs, lighting improvements, barrier installations, and advanced monitoring systems.
